Injury Update: Fernandes and Mainoo to Miss Key Match Against Newcastle
MANCHESTER, England (AP) — Manchester United’s manager, Ruben Amorim, has provided an update on the injury status of key midfielders Bruno Fernandes and Kobbie Mainoo ahead of their crucial Premier League match against Newcastle this Friday. Despite the disappointing news that both players will miss the game, Amorim expressed a sense of optimism regarding their recovery.
The Injury Situation
Bruno Fernandes, the team’s captain and playmaker, suffered a hamstring injury during Manchester United’s recent defeat against Aston Villa. The injury was described as a soft tissue problem, which typically requires careful management and rehabilitation. After the match, Fernandes was visibly distressed, clutching his hamstring, which raised immediate concerns among fans and the coaching staff alike.
Kobbie Mainoo, another promising talent in the midfield, is also sidelined due to an unspecified injury. While the exact nature of his condition has not been disclosed, Amorim confirmed that Mainoo’s absence will be felt as the team prepares for one of the most challenging fixtures of the season against Newcastle United.
Amorim’s Optimism
Despite the setbacks, Amorim’s tone during the press conference was notably optimistic. He indicated that both players are progressing well and that their injuries are not as severe as initially feared. “Injuries are part of football, and while it’s disappointing to lose key players, we have to remain positive and focus on the squad that is available,” Amorim stated. His confidence in the rest of the team suggests a commitment to overcoming these challenges and maintaining a competitive edge.
